I have had Pandora's Box for two years, and this year it really put on a show. It supposedly is very susceptible to rust, but so far, so good--and I have rust in my yard! It is so pretty that it can stay as long as it is rust-free!

Scapes were a bit taller than 19" here.

Here's my annual evaluation. Pandora's Box, is still in its old location, too many new plants going in to futz with this one. It's fine where it is. Not a tremendous amount of bloom this year but it's an early bird in my garden and we had a hot dry June after a fairly dry winter. Still, it seems to be taller than in previous years, so maybe it's responding to being fed in the Spring. The first photo is from five days ago, that might have been its last bloom

I paid $8 for Pandora's Box in 2008 and kept it for 6 years, but as I got more into daylilies, I was looking for other features, so I gave it to my sisters. I still have all my pictures of it to remind me of how it grew here. It was a nice plant and would be good at the front of the border since it is short.

7/2/2011. This picture shows that some scapes get 3-way branching and around 15 buds, but some pictures only show 2-way branching.

6/26/2014. It has small fans and it multiplied well. It bloomed from about mid-June to the first part of July, around 3 weeks and the blooms were cream-colored and sat just above the foliage. I prefer blooms to be well above the foliage, so may be another reason I got rid of it.
